Quick note for release days at Fernhollow: our app leans hard on connection pooling, so don't bounce the pooler mid-deploy or you'll strand half the checkout queries. Drain the pool first (the runbook script handles it), wait for active sessions to hit zero, then roll. The pooler config bundle is signed before distribution, and releases should be verified against the key below.

release key, yagap-kagag: bky6_1ks93y

## Migration Step 4: Hermetic Toolchain Cutover

Before switching the Larkspur build to the hermetic executor, verify that no build rule reaches outside the declared input set. Audit the sandbox manifest, confirm network egress is disabled for all compile actions, and pin every toolchain archive by digest. The fetch proxy requires authenticated access so that cache poisoning attempts are traceable to a principal. Create the env file in the deploy vault, then append the proxy credential on the next line.

secret setting of bajeg-yahog: LEDGER_TOKEN20=f833f3e2e6625ec0dee3

Ticket: Staging env misconfigured for Siftgate bloom filter

The bloom layer in front of the Pellet KV store is rejecting all lookups in staging because the env file was copied from the dev template without credentials. False-positive tuning values are fine; only the auth line is missing. To unblock the weekly demo, the Pellet admission secret must be set on the following line.

env line for yaguf-fajop: LEDGER_TOKEN13=fb08984397349

### v4.2.0 — Dependency pinning policy update

All direct dependencies in the Quarrelbox monorepo are now pinned to exact versions; ranges are rejected by the pre-merge lint. Transitive versions are locked via the refreshed lockfile, regenerated weekly by the Brambleton CI job. Reviewers should flag any `^` or `~` specifiers in diffs. Questions about exemptions should go to the policy owner named below.

account owner for bawip-tahag: Raleth Quenok